How they compare
Norway currently reports 48 against 28.6 in Germany, a difference of 19.4.
That makes Norway's figure about 1.7 times Germany's.
Across all 27 years both countries report, Norway has been ahead every year.
Germany ranks 8th and Norway ranks 5th of 35 countries.
Norway has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Germany | Norway |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 29.1 | 43.9 | 14.8 | Norway |
| 2000s | 27.28 | 41.95 | 14.67 | Norway |
| 2010s | 26.67 | 34.13 | 7.46 | Norway |
| 2020s | 27.93 | 43.48 | 15.55 | Norway |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
